黄土堂香主
阅读权限 2
积分 5217
侠名
UID 981
主题
帖子
精华
好友
银子
金子
贡献
威望
推广
活跃
荣耀
注册时间 2018-11-1
最后登录 1970-1-1
在线时间 小时
个人主页
|
【游客模式】——注册会员,加入11RIA 闪客社区吧!一起见证Flash的再次辉煌……
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
一直没弄明白如何让movieClip与装载它的stage或movieClip怎么通信,今天弄明白了。如下例
舞台上加载了类textLoader的一个实例,名叫myloader。
myloader的作用就是加载一个名部的txt文件,这个要时间,加载完了,它要告诉舞台,我加载完了,你可以开始干活了。那么写法就是:
1.在类txtLoader里写代码
dispatchEvent(new Event("ACTION"));这个事件,当然是写在它自己加载完后的代码里。
2.然后主程序里就监听这个事件,并得到事件后执行actionOut
这里的myloader就是txtLoader在主程序里的名字。
myloader.addEventListener("ACTION",actionOut);
function actionOut(event:Event):void
{
trace("子程序已完成加载");
}
完整的实例代码有好多别的内容,就不贴了。 |
评分
-
参与人数 2 | 银子 +110 |
金子 +1 |
贡献 +1 |
收起
理由
|
TKCB
| + 10 |
+ 1 |
+ 1 |
11RIA 闪客社区,就是这么专业 |
danceman
| + 100 |
|
|
11RIA 大神就是大神,佩服佩服 |
查看全部评分
|